Output ffe328b171e6558f736fedc63f96060be48b62addac687c4deaf546d3e332eeb:29

value
2600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81a49969e376ca86fa4ef1d9cfac0f45449607ac OP_EQUAL
address
3DWWGr8Dx9V8SYvLkgDbKnMyrRH5mXSX7Q
transaction
ffe328b171e6558f736fedc63f96060be48b62addac687c4deaf546d3e332eeb
confirmations
411757
spent
true